Military exposure

Many veterans served in the military during a time when asbestos was heavily used. The toxic material was used in military bases, aircrafts ships, vehicles, and bases. Unfortunately, these companies knew about the health risks of their products, but they concealed this information from the military in order to boost profits. These women and men were unaware of the dangers, until they contracted asbestos-related diseases like mesothelioma, for instance, many years later.

The military used Asbestos as it was strong and resistant to fire. It was used in insulation as well as in the manufacture of vehicles and ships and even in clothing. Asbestos has been discovered in a variety of military facilities including Army bases, Navy yard and Coast Guard vessels. All branches of the military are vulnerable to asbestos-related illnesses, but veterans of the Army have a higher risk of getting asbestos-related diseases.

For the majority of its time, the United States Army relied heavily on asbestos-based materials. Army servicemen and women that worked in boiler rooms or engine areas could be exposed to the hazardous substance. Additionally to this, the Air Force also utilized numerous asbestos-based products. The risk of exposure also extended to pilots, mechanics and other personnel who worked in the cockpit.

Because mesothelioma symptoms typically don't manifest until 20-50 years after exposure, many veterans have been diagnosed with the disease. Veterans Affairs may be able to offer benefits for these men and women. These benefits could cover the cost of treatment for mesothelioma and other diseases.

A VA disability claim could allow a veteran to gain access to the top mesothelioma specialists around the world. It also provides compensation for living expenses and other costs associated with mesothelioma. However the VA claim is not an alternative to an individual injury lawsuit against the asbestos-related companies that caused the exposure.

Florida veterans diagnosed with mesothelioma should look into the Sylvester Comprehensive Cancer Center for treatment. The facility is located only a short distance from the Miami VA Medical Center and is part of the Veterans Choice Program, which lets veterans choose their own doctor. The mesothelioma specialists at the Center include Dr. Nestor R. Villamizar Ortiz who is a VA-accredited physician.

Bankruptcy

Companies that expose victims to asbestos in a reckless, knowingly way can be held accountable for their actions. Some of these companies declared bankruptcy to stay out of liability for their actions. The bankruptcy of a company can stop any lawsuits that are pending. The victims can still make trust fund claims against the bankrupt company. These funds are set up during the bankruptcy process to pay mesothelioma patients.

A mesothelioma victim can receive compensation from mesothelioma trust funds, personal injury insurance, veterans benefits or an asbestos lawsuit.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ist a victim in obtaining the most money. An experienced mesothelioma attorney will manage the entire claim process, so victims can focus on treatment and their loved family members.

To receive compensation, mesothelioma patients must prove their asbestos exposure and the diagnosis. A victim must submit an official proof of their mesothelioma diagnosis, certified by a physician or mesothelioma litigation specialist. The documentation must include an biopsy, x-ray, or other test result. The victim must also provide an mesothelioma diagnosis to be eligible for compensation.

The median payout from mesothelioma compensation claims is $180,000. Some victims receive more than $100,000 in compensation. The amount of compensation a victim gets is contingent on the mesothelioma type and the severity of symptoms.

Asbestos victims can receive financial compensation from the bankruptcy trust funds of asbestos-related companies and lawsuits for wrongful deaths of victims who have died. Wrongful Death lawsuits allow family members or loved relatives to sue the estate of a victim for financial damages.

Although a lawsuit may be more complex than filing an appeal from a trust fund an attorney for mesothelioma attorneys will ensure that the rights of the client are secured. Lawyers can examine asbestos insurance claims and trust funds, and can also file a lawsuit for mesothelioma on behalf of the victim.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ma can make sure that the statute of limitations has not expired, and also that the other legal requirements have been met. This is particularly important for victims who are unable to bring a lawsuit due to condition or age.

Filing a lawsuit

A mesothelioma lawsuit is a way that victims of asbestos exposure can hold corporations accountable. Asbestos lawsuits seek compensation for victims, and often result in large settlements. Financial compensation can help victims pay mesothelioma treatment costs and other costs. It can also provide for the families. Not all asbestos victims are eligible for a mesothelioma lawsuit. Some asbestos victims may be entitled to disability payments or a payout from a mesothelioma law firm foundation.

The procedure for filing a mesothelioma lawsuit is complicated, and the time frame for compensation may differ based on a variety of factors. It is essential to hire a m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led in this area of law. Lawyers can help victims comprehend their rights and ensure the best possible outcome.

Victims and their families bring lawsuits against companies for their actions. Many asbestos companies were aware that asbestos was dangerous and did not inform workers, resulting in exposure to asbestos. Asbestos fibers can be inhaled or eaten, and can cause mesothelioma and lung cancer.

There are two kinds of mesothelioma lawsuits which are personal injury and wrongful death. Personal injury mesothelioma lawsuits have a statute of limitations of 2-3 years following the diagnosis. For wrongful death mesothelioma cases, the statute of limitations begin when a loved one dies from mesothelioma or an asbestos-related illness.

Compensation for mesothelioma cases could include compensation for medical expenses, lost income, and pain and suffering. Compensation can differ based on the severity and type of symptoms, aswell as the place of work where the victim was employed. A mesothelioma attorney will examine the asbestos and mesothelioma history to determine their potential exposure.

In certain cases mesothelioma lawyers may negotiate a settlement before filing an action. This can be more cost-effective and efficient than bringing a mesothelioma claim to trial. In most cases, a mesothelioma lawyer will recommend that the lawsuit be tried in court to ensure that victims get the compensation they are entitled to. A jury verdict can often result in higher awards than a settlement.
